1966 Matchless G85CS. Full restoration. I have done 6 of these in the past 13 years and kept the most perfect one for my collection. this is an all matching numbers bike and is 1 of 97 built. This one is the 2nd. to last one made. $20K USD


1959 Manx 350. non matching numbers. 5spd. Shaftlitner, Manx 4LS front brake, coil spring conversion, Belt Primary, extra sprint tank and full gearing. Last raced in New Zealand 2003..won all 3 races entered. A very fast 350. 5 races on engine. $34K USD


1987 Ducati F1 Laguna Seca..(RARE) in this condition. It is a race bike and has never been converted for the street. 1 of 200 specials made. Some spares included, extra set of matching wheels and special tools and stands. $20K USD


1962 500 Manx. Replica with history, Molnar std. engine, but with many mods...has dyno out at 49.6 at the rear wheel. Has McIntosh full roller and std. 4spd. box. Molnar full floating rear brake. front brake is a 4LS Manx. Fairing and all hardware are Rickman. $37K USD OBO


1966 Rickman/Kirby G50 Metisse. Factory race bike. Ridden most likely by names like Bill Ivy, Alan Barnett, Paddy Driver and John Hartle. 3 races on engine. Custom built 2002 MV Agusta F4 EVO2. This is not a Salvage. I did this as a tribute to Mike Hailwood.

I purchased the bike last year, as the owner had hit something and put a kink in the frame. I decided not too have the frame repaired, and that I would have MV Agusta in Italy build a new replacement frame with the same VIN numbers, well 6 months and $3500.00 later I got it, but during that waiting time I decided to go all out and build this as a tribute to one of the greatest road racers of all time and who did so much for MV in the 60`s. Evidently the Italian factory has forgotten about the British riders that made them famous.
